The key blank you need is HU92 than with cuts from the key head 44211231.
( i think they say old type as for CAS2 was the old diamond shape head remote with HU92 blade in earlier versions, and the newer type was the "smart key" with only a hole where you insert the whole key).

I get remote keys from Uobd2 for this car, pretty cheap (around 22 usd ) and always worked for me, and you can change freq. with changing a resistor's position.
You can find it as remote key for BMW 3/5 series or something like this, and the transponder will be 7941.
